查询数据库实例和查询数据库实例列表,用户需要根据实际的应用环境和需求选择合适的方法,在Oracle和SQL Server等主流数据库系统中,都有相应的命令或接口可以用于查询当前的数据库实例或是列出所有的数据库实例,以便进行管理和操作,下面详细介绍这些查询方式:
1、Oracle数据库实例查询
查询当前数据库名:使用SELECT NAME,DBID FROM V$DATABASE;
或者SHOW PARAMETER DB_NAME;
命令,这两种命令都可以获取当前Oracle数据库的名称信息。
查询当前实例名:通过SELECT INSTANCE_NAME FROM V$INSTANCE;
或者SHOW PARAMETER INSTANCE_NAME;
命令来查询,这样可以得到当前Oracle数据库的实例名。
连接到数据库并切换实例:可以通过sqlplus / as sysdba
命令连接到数据库,并通过show parameter name
命令查看当前的实例配置,这有助于了解当前数据库环境的配置情况。
查看所有实例列表:虽然文档中没有直接提供查看所有实例列表的命令,但通过登录到Oracle数据库服务器,并查阅相关配置文件,通常可以找出所有配置的数据库实例。
2、SQL Server数据库实例查询
查询当前数据库名称:使用SELECT DB_NAME() AS
命令,可以快速获取当前SQL Server数据库的名称,这是一个非常简单且直接的方法。
查询所有数据库列表:在SQL Server中,可以使用SHOW DATABASES;
或者SHOW SCHEMAS;
命令来查询当前实例中的所有数据库列表,通过执行SELECT SCHEMA_NAME FROM INFORMATION_SCHEMA.SCHEMATA;
也可以获得详细的数据库列表。
3、云数据库实例列表查询
查询云数据库实例:对于云数据库,特定云平台提供的接口如DescribeDBInstances
可用于查询云数据库实例列表,这种接口支持通过项目ID、实例ID、访问地址、实例状态等多种条件进行筛选,如果不指定筛选条件,则默认返回实例列表。
查询数据库实例和数据库实例列表主要涉及到Oracle和SQL Server两种主流数据库系统的操作,通过特定的SQL命令或接口,可以实现对当前数据库实例的查询以及对数据库实例列表的检索,对于云数据库服务,也有相应的接口用于筛选和获取实例信息,用户需要根据自己的实际环境和需求,选择适合的查询方法。
由于我无法直接创建实际的介绍,我将以文本形式模拟一个查询数据库实例列表的介绍结构,假设我们要展示以下字段:实例ID,实例名称,数据库类型,状态,创建时间。
++++++ | 实例ID | 实例名称 | 数据库类型 | 状态 | 创建时间 | ++++++ | ins12345 | MyDBInstance | MySQL | 运行中 | 20231101 10:00 | | ins23456 | AnotherDB | PostgreSQL | 创建中 | 20231102 15:30 | | ins34567 | DevDB | SQLServer | 已停止 | 20231103 09:45 | | ins45678 | TestDB | MongoDB | 运行中 | 20231104 14:20 | ++++++
请注意,这只是一个文本表示,实际的介绍可能会在不同的软件或平台上拥有不同的格式和样式,如果你需要在实际应用程序或数据库管理工具中查看这样的介绍,你可能需要使用相应的查询语句或操作界面。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/712729.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复